How Much Does it Cost to Move from Cleveland to Clarksville?

Moving a 1 bedroom apartment 547 miles from Cleveland, OH to Clarksville, TN will cost on average $2,246 to hire full service movers. A 3 bedroom Cleveland to Clarksville move is roughly $5,381. See the chart below for a detailed breakdown by type of move and home size. Pricing will vary based upon the exact locations of pickup and dropoff as well as several other factors. The most important pricing component that is often overlooked is how far away the move date is. The earlier you can reserve movers, the better your pricing and options will be.

Cleveland vs. Clarksville Weather Considerations

Moving from one city to another means adapting to new weather patterns. Understanding how the climate in Cleveland, OH compares to Clarksville, TN can help you prepare for your relocation. This comparison highlights key differences in temperature, sunshine, and potential natural hazards you might face.

While both cities experience all four seasons, moving from Cleveland to Clarksville will mean warmer winters and hotter summers for you. Clarksville enjoys more days of sunshine annually, which contributes to its slightly lower average humidity. Importantly, the difference in natural disasters is notable, with Clarksville facing a higher risk of tornadoes but significantly less annual snowfall. This information can help guide your preparation, especially in choosing appropriate clothing and planning for potential weather disruptions.

Cleveland vs. Clarksville Traffic and Public Transit Considerations

Moving to a new city can significantly alter your daily commute and navigation habits. This comparison aims to clarify the differences in traffic and transportation options between Cleveland, OH, and Clarksville, TN, helping you better understand what to expect when driving or using public transit in these cities.

In Cleveland, you'll find a reasonable level of traffic congestion relative to its size, and the availability of public transit, such as buses and trains, is fairly good, making it possible to navigate the city without a car, although challenging. Clarksville, while having shorter average commute times, experiences less traffic congestion. However, public transit options are notably more limited, making it difficult to rely on anything but personal or shared vehicular transportation. This comparison highlights the importance of considering your commute and transportation needs when relocating, especially if moving from a city with robust public transit systems like Cleveland to one where a car might be more of a necessity, like Clarksville.
